引言
随着互联网的普及和数字化转型的加速,网络安全问题日益凸显。网络漏洞作为网络安全的主要威胁之一,时刻威胁着个人、企业和国家的信息安全。了解网络漏洞的原理、类型和防御方法,对于我们保护数字世界至关重要。
网络漏洞概述
什么是网络漏洞?
网络漏洞是指网络系统中存在的安全缺陷或弱点,可能被黑客利用来进行攻击。这些漏洞可能存在于软件、硬件、协议或配置中。
网络漏洞的危害
- 数据泄露:黑客通过漏洞获取敏感信息,如个人信息、企业机密等。
- 系统瘫痪:攻击者利用漏洞破坏系统,导致服务中断。
- 资产损失:企业遭受网络攻击,可能导致经济损失。
- 影响声誉:网络攻击事件可能损害个人或企业的声誉。
常见网络漏洞类型
1. 软件漏洞
软件漏洞是网络漏洞中最常见的一种,主要包括以下类型:
- 缓冲区溢出:攻击者通过向缓冲区写入超出其容量的数据,导致程序崩溃或执行恶意代码。
- SQL注入:攻击者通过在SQL语句中注入恶意代码,从而获取数据库权限。
- 跨站脚本攻击(XSS):攻击者通过在网页中注入恶意脚本,窃取用户信息。
2. 硬件漏洞
硬件漏洞是指硬件设备中存在的安全缺陷,主要包括以下类型:
- 物理漏洞:攻击者通过物理手段获取设备访问权限。
- 硬件后门:制造商在设备中植入的后门程序,用于非法访问设备。
3. 协议漏洞
协议漏洞是指网络协议中存在的安全缺陷,主要包括以下类型:
- SSL/TLS漏洞:攻击者通过破解SSL/TLS协议,窃取用户信息。
- DNS漏洞:攻击者通过篡改DNS解析结果,将用户引导至恶意网站。
防御网络漏洞的方法
1. 定期更新和打补丁
及时更新系统和应用程序,修复已知漏洞,降低被攻击的风险。
2. 使用强密码策略
设置复杂且难以猜测的密码,并定期更换密码。
3. 部署安全设备
使用防火墙、入侵检测系统等安全设备,监控网络流量,防止攻击。
4. 提高安全意识
加强网络安全教育,提高用户对网络威胁的认识,避免点击不明链接、下载未知来源的文件等。
5. 实施安全审计
定期进行安全审计,发现和修复潜在的安全漏洞。
总结
网络漏洞是网络安全的主要威胁之一,了解网络漏洞的原理、类型和防御方法,对于我们保护数字世界至关重要。通过采取有效的防御措施,我们可以降低被攻击的风险,构建一个更加安全的数字世界。